Xanadu by SammieComment: 8 - Wow. Very nice contrast of landscapes. Criticism; not much, mostly the sky detracts in my opinion in this shot. Whether you were able to adjust it (contrast etc) not sure, but perhaps an even tighter crop (less sky) would have made this a better shot in my opinion, although I realize you'd lose some 'context'. Like the shadow play on the dunes and mountains, but wonder if just a fraction more 'lightness' overall, possibly showing some more of the green in the mountains may have also made it better. Perhaps even more of the fore 'plain' too, especially if cropping out more sky, not sure, who knows. Good shot. |

In the valleyby alithenakeComment: 7 - Very good. However I have no idea if the horizon is straight, based on the 'slant' of the houses and the clouds, etc so not sure (apologies if wrong). Criticism; not much, perhaps a bit sharper on the fence post(s), but maybe you would lose the definition in the 'scene'. The shot has the potential for a more dramatic feel in my opinion, but perhaps you were not going for that, but if so, maybe a tweaking of the contrasts, etc, especially bringing out a bit more coloring. Has a nice 'feel' to it as is though. Good perspective. |
